Transaction 5a57488c58787e256591eef17717497e12b1497991ad7a16a223689d50f1452d

2 Input
2 Outputs
  • 5a57488c58787e256591eef17717497e12b1497991ad7a16a223689d50f1452d:0
  • value  1822125
    address  3HWD164cLkiw8gC5AYhYJoRPhgz15KsiYj
  • 5a57488c58787e256591eef17717497e12b1497991ad7a16a223689d50f1452d:1
  • value  1013368
    address  3Qnr3ZSZPR5DA4NLBHLwFGouEEfSiGdXsb